chiark / gitweb /
Automate creation of Bedbugs.rule
[bedbugs.git] / src / Makefile
index 8c41a029058a16d8189d240b7375b562faf08dd8..fc8c0a013f495d05b2221233011adcd8f2981da4 100644 (file)
@@ -1,12 +1,12 @@
-all: bedbugs.rule mungedlife.table
+../Bedbugs.rule: bedbugs mungedlife.table
+       ./bedbugs <Bedbugs.rule.template >../Bedbugs.rule
 
 clean:
-       rm bedbugs bedbugs.rule make-ruletable life.table mungedlife.table
+       rm -f bedbugs make-ruletable life.table mungedlife.table
+reallyquiteclean: clean
+       rm -f ../Bedbugs.rule
 .PHONY: clean
 
-bedbugs.rule: bedbugs
-       ./bedbugs >bedbugs.rule
-
 mungedlife.table: life.table mungetable.pl
        perl mungetable.pl <life.table >mungedlife.table